Integration of augmented and virtual reality:

Education and training:

By 2027, it is expected that the global market for VR learning will have grown to a staggering $5.2 billion, with AR education solutions following closely behind.

Healthcare:

Research reveals that 70% of phobia sufferers experience reduced anxiety after using virtual reality, and comparable benefits are shown in pain relief and rehabilitation. By 2027, it's anticipated that the worldwide VR healthcare market would grow to $9.7 billion, providing opportunities for medical professionals and giving patients hope.

Manufacturing:

AR overlays save development time and costs by enabling engineers to make real-time design adjustments. With efficiency and innovation at its core, the global AR in manufacturing market is projected to reach $63.2 billion by 2025.

Retail and entertainment:

AR increases consumer happiness and lowers return rates by enabling customers to experience products before they buy. By 2026, it's anticipated that global AR in the retail sector would reach $150.9 billion, revolutionizing how consumers purchase and interact with goods.

The next big thing:

Prepare for touch-simulating VR gloves and suits, which will further enhance the realism of virtual encounters in the era of metaverse technology in the workplace. The haptic revolution is only getting started, with a $52.9 billion global industry predicted by 2027.

What is a metaverse office?

A metaverse virtual office is a workplace situated within a sizable virtual environment called a metaverse office space. In the metaverse, a virtual office is created to look like a real office in a virtual environment. Imagine walking into a 3D office where you can work on projects, collaborate with coworkers, and take part in meetings from the comfort of your own home or anyplace else you may be.

While virtual offices have long been discussed, the metaverse virtual office elevates the conversation. Online virtual workplaces used to be basic and unpretentious, like plain images on a screen. However, metaverse offices are now incredibly lifelike thanks to augmented reality (AR) and virtual reality (VR). With 3D characters, interactive elements, and even tactile input, they give you the impression that you are truly there.

Within VR, the initial version of this individual, metaversal work bubble is already emerging. Currently, meetings and other time-limited, "in-person" collaboration are a major aspect of our professional lives that are often overlooked in virtual work environments.

However, a new type of workspace will appear as VR technologies advance—think about headsets that are comfortable to wear all day and higher resolution images. Presenting the online private office.

We'll be able to enter a virtual space and set up several screens in a way that works best for the job at hand. Keyboards and additional hardware will be rendered inside this virtual environment and synchronized with our VR platform.

As for passthrough functionality, which lets you "see" the outside world even when wearing virtual reality glasses, it lets you draw limits around your virtual area and view your actual surroundings when you look past them. This transforms your virtual private office into a mixed reality experience rather than just a VR one.

Numerous 'on-screen internet' productivity tools will also be integrated. Have a Zoom call scheduled soon? You may answer calls using a new floating virtual window by simply tapping the Zoom app, eliminating the need to leave your virtual office. The emerging reality is a mobile, mixed-reality work bubble that is personal to each individual.
